Re: Newbie: How to insert text box?
On the Toolbar next to the Navigator button (see NWP001).
Click that button: It will tell you to draw the text box anywhere (NWP002)
Completed (NWP003), note that it is anchored to whatever paragraph was selected (far left side).

Re: A Very Simple (too simple) Style Question
Howdy. If you go to Preferences > New File > Advanced. On the right side, click on “Open for Editing”. That opens the Nisus New File.dot. Then create styles as you normally would.
